well i was drivin home last night i dropped it to third and right at about 7500 rpm's the motor sounded like it hit rev limiter and shut off.. so i coasted to my drive way and got it into the garage.. we took off the head and this is what we found..again sorry the pics are huge i havent figured out how to make them smaller... i dont know why the valve snapped.. i was running ctr cams without the dual valve springs.. so that might have been the problem.. i havent even had the motor for a year.. and i was just geting ready to buy a turbo today.. now its time for a new b16 project. and next time im puttin in the dual valve springs..
